Ir al contenido principal

Clase VII - 16052019 - Control de estructuras y relaciones

Descargar ejercicios Caso Productos

Captura de datos 
La captura de datos ha recibido cada vez más atención como el punto en el procesamiento de la información en el que se puede obtener excelentes ganancias en productividad. 
La decisión sobre lo que se debe capturar es más importante que la interacción del usuario con el sistema. 
Hay dos tipos de datos a introducir: 
  • los datos que cambian o varían con cada transacción y 
  • los datos que diferencian en forma concisa el elemento específico que se está procesando de los demás elementos. 
¿Qué capturar?
Al considerar qué dato en necesario capturar para cada transacción y qué datos hay que dejar para que el sistema los introduzca, se debe aprovechar lo que las computadoras hacen mejor. 
La computadora puede almacenar y acceder a esta información con facilidad. 
Las computadoras pueden manejar de manera automática las tareas repetitivas, como  calcular nuevos valores a partir de una entrada, además de almacenar y recuperar datos bajo demanda. 
Al emplear las mejores características de las computadoras, el diseño de la captura de datos eficiente evita la entrada de datos innecesarios.
Entre menos pasos se requieran para introducir datos, menor será la probabilidad de introducir errores.

Asegurar la calidad de los datos por medio de la validación de la entrada
Problemas potenciales al validar la entrada 
  • Enviar datos incorrectos.- este error trata de introducir datos incorrectos o que no se ingresan en el lugar correspondiente, por lo regular este error es accidental. 
  • Prueba de datos faltantes.- en algunos casos es necesario que estén presentes todos los datos para que el proceso sea válido. 
  • Longitud de campo incorrecta.- en este se comprueba la entrada para ver si tienen la longitud correcta para el campo. Si son erróneos se pueden considerar erróneos y no ser procesados. 
  • Tipo de campo incorrecto (cadena, fecha, numérico,etc. ).
  • Entrada / captura de datos de rango / límite / intervalo incorrecta (valores máximos y mínimos o lista de valores válidos que se pueden almacenar).
Validar datos de entrada: 
  • Prueba de clase o composición.-determina que un determinado campo solo contenga los caracteres correspondientes y no incluya ambos (que un campo solo contenga caracteres numéricos o viceversa).
  • Prueba de rango. - verificar el límite superior o inferior. (Por ej. no  permitirá una fecha del mes 13) 
  • Prueba de valores inválidos.-se realizan para valores discretos, donde los campos solo puedan tener ciertos valores.
  • Prueba para comparar con datos almacenados.- se comparan los datos que se introducen con los datos que ya están almacenados (un producto que se introduce se puede comparar con el inventario para asegurar que se haya introducido de forma correcta) 
Ejemplo: En la sgte. tabla se almacena información de los clientes de una empresa.
IdDNI Apellido Nombre  IdLocalidad   CA Saldo Fecha
17724298 Pérez  José 2252 456  $ 4.500 25/04/2019
28456665 Arri Jaqquelina 2252 566  $    500 25/04/2019
34599000 Estévez Luciano 2246 422  $    700 25/04/2019
19345666 Prietto Lúcas 2252 675  $    800 25/04/2019
27898392 Juarez Lorena 2242 672  $ 9.880 25/04/2019


¿Qué errores podría cometer el operador al cargar un nuevo registro?

Respecto al idDNI, al cargar un nuevo registro podría:
Ingresar ... 
  • un valor alfabético cuando el sistema espera un dato numérico (error de tipo / composición).
  • un valor negativo cuando el sistema espera un valor positivo (error de rango).
  • un valor flotante (decimal) cuando el sistema espera un valor entero (error de tipo).
  • un espacio en blanco ( o sin cargar) cuando el sistema espera un valor entero, positivo, de 8 posiciones máximo de longitud (error de d faltantes).
  • un valor entero, positivo, de 9 dígitos (error de rango / longitud).
¿Entonces qué debería validarse?

Siguiendo con el ejemplo para idDNI: 

Longitud: entre 7 y 8 posiciones
Tipo: numérico, entero, positivo
Existencia  (es decir, que no esté ne blanco).
Duplicado de identificador / clave (redundancia).

Validación de datos en Excel


La validación de datos se usa para controlar el tipo de datos o los valores que los usuarios pueden escribir en una celda. Por ejemplo, es posible que desee restringir la entrada de datos a un intervalo determinado de fechas, limitar las opciones con una lista o asegurarse de que sólo se escriben números enteros positivos.
La validación de datos es una función de Excel que permite establecer restricciones respecto a los datos que se pueden o se deben escribir en una celda. Puede configurarse para impedir que los usuarios escriban datos no válidos. También puede proporcionar mensajes para indicar qué tipo de entradas se esperan en una celda, así como instrucciones para ayudar a los usuarios a corregir los errores.

Pasos

1- Seleccione las celdas para las que quiere crear una regla.
2- Seleccione la ficha Datos à Validación de datos (dblClick)
3- En la pestaña Configuración, en Permitir, seleccione una opción:

    1. Cualquier valor
    2. Número entero : para restringir la celda para que acepte solo números enteros.
    3. Decimal : para restringir la celda para que acepte solo números decimales.
    4. Lista: para elegir datos de una lista desplegable.
    5. Fecha: para restringir la celda para que solo se acepten fechas.
    6. Hora : para restringir la celda para que solo acepte la hora.
    7. Longitud del texto: para restringir la longitud del texto.
    8. Personalizada: para fórmulas personalizadas.
4- En Datos, seleccione una condición
5- Seleccione la casilla Omitir blancos para omitir los espacios en blanco.
Si desea agregar un título y un mensaje para la regla, seleccione la pestaña mensaje de entrada y, a continuación, escriba un título y un mensaje de entrada.
6- Seleccione la casilla Mostrar mensaje de entrada al seleccionar la celda para mostrar el mensaje cuando el usuario seleccione las celdas seleccionadas o mantenga el mouse sobre estas.
7- Seleccione Aceptar.

Si se escoge la opción Personalizada se pueden validar las capturas de datos utilizando fórmulas y funciones.



Funciones más usadas:
Para el control de la longitud de un dato: 
=Largo(dirección)   / Ej.: =Largo(D4)

Para el control del tipo de dato: 
=ESNUMERO(dirección) / Ej.: =ESNUMERO(R5)
=ESTEXTO(dirección)/ Ej.: =ESTEXTO(C34)
=ESBLANCO(dirección)/ Ej.: = ESBLANCO(A12)

Para el control de datos duplicados:
=CONTAR.SI(rango; dirección primer elemento del rango) =1 / Ej. =CONTAR.SI($L$5:$L$14;L5) =1

Para el control de rango:


=SI(prueba lógica; "Valor si verdadero"; "Valor si Falso") / Ej. =SI(A1 > B4; "A1 almacena el mayor valor"; "A1 no almacena en mayor valor")
=Y(valor lógico 1; valor lógico 2; ...) / Ej. =Y(15>2; 28>26)  Resultado verdadero
=O(valor lógico 1; valor lógico 2; .../ Ej. =O(15>2; 4>6)  Resultado verdadero, porque una de las dos comparaciones es verdadera.

Ejemplos para el control de rango

Por ejemplo, para verificar si la celda A5 tiene un valor numérico comprendido entre 500 y 600, la función es =SI(Y(A5>=500; A5<=600); "Correcto";"Incorrecto")


Por ejemplo, para verificar si la celda A5 tiene un texto de la lista formada por "Gálvez, Coronda y Arocena" la función es =SI(O(A6="Gálvez"; A6="Coronda"; A6 ="Arocena");"Correcto"; "Incorrecto") 
Esta función no distingue entre mayúsculas y minúsculas, pero sí entre vocales acentuadas y no acentuadas.


Solución ejercicios Caso Productos

Organización de datos (1)



Organización de datos (2)



Organización de datos (3)






Comentarios

Entradas populares de este blog

Clase XXVII- 25102019 - Funciones y fórmulas Excel - TP Plan Maestro de Producción

Pasos para desarrollar el TP PMP en Excel 1. Crear en hojas separadas tablas de datos para las estructuras "Viajantes" y "Productos" según: 2. Calcular el stock para cada producto en la tabla de Productos: 3. Crear en una nueva hoja, la tabla Pedidos según: 3.a.  Determina qué datos deben ser cargados por el operador, cuáles calculados por el sistema y cuáles tomados de las tablas creadas anteriormente. 3.b.  Utiliza los recursos que Excel ofrece para realizar validaciones en las capturas de los datos de cada registro. 3.c. Ofrece retroalimentación al usuario en caso de error. 3.d. Realiza pruebas con datos de  prueba para depurar los mecanismos implementados en la tabla. Se sugiere usar la sgte. estrategia: 4. Ordenar los datos por fecha de pedido.     Agruparlos en 8 períodos / semanas y determinar la cantidad pedida para cada período según: 5. Realizar pruebas de control comprobando la exac...

Clase XXII - 26092019 - Aplicación lineamientos de diseño TP - Punto de equilibrio

Aplicación lineamientos de diseño TP - Punto de equilibrio en Excel Temas abordados en clase Menú Revisar  - Ficha Revisión Menú Diseño de página - Ficha Configuración de página Menú Inicio  - Ficha Fuentes Menú Inicio  - Ficha Párrafo Menú Inicio  - Ficha Estilos Menú Referencias  - Ficha Notas al pie Menú Insertar  - Ficha Encabezado y pie de página Menú Inicio  - Ficha Ilustraciones Menú Herramientas de imagen - Submenú Formato - Ficha Organizar - Botón Posición Menú Inicio  - Ficha Vínculos - Botón Hipervínculos Menú Referencias  - Ficha Tabla de contenido Menú Insertar  - Ficha Páginas - Página en blanco Menú Insertar  - Ficha Páginas - Salto de página Herramientas - Uso de la regla Menú Insertar  - Ficha Textos Instructivo Word ·          Leer el documento. Corregir errores gramaticales y de ortografía. ·         ...

Clase XXIII - 03102019 - Aplicación lineamientos de diseño TP - Punto de equilibrio

Aplicación lineamientos de diseño TP - Punto de equilibrio en una presentación Manual Powerpoint  Power Point es un programa de Microsoft Office para realizar presentaciones que permite diseñar  diapositivas con texto, imágenes, videos, hiperenlaces y animaciones. Esta herramienta es una de las más extendidas para crear un apoyo visual dinámico en las exposiciones.   Una presentación es un acto de comunicación , Powerpoint es una herramienta utilizada para comunicar ideas en forma visual ( a través de diapositivas),  por lo tanto, se debe: Exponer un objetivo claro. Debemos contar a nuestra audiencia qué van a ver en la presentación. ¿Vamos a hablar de algo realizado o de un proyecto? ¿Queremos exponer un tema, una idea, un proyecto?  Transmitir emociones para lograr efectividad (seguridad, coherencia, efectivo). Crear dramatismo. Es importante mantener la tensión en el público incorporando elementos inesperados y que provoquen la sorpre...